Kellie Bright: Strictly helped with my pregnancy

Kellie Bright believes starring on ‘Strictly Come Dancing’ helped her get pregnant.
The ‘EastEnders’ star – who is expecting her second child with husband Paul Stocker – says appearing on the BBC One dancing show helped take the focus off trying for a baby.
She said: "We started trying when I was 34, nearly 35. I fell pregnant very easily. But with the second one it was a different story.
"I think ‘Strictly’ helped as it took the focus off trying and the fact that I was nearing 40. We were trying for more than a year and I was very aware that I wasn’t getting any younger. We feel very lucky that we’re having another baby."
The 40-year-old actress also gushed about her on-screen husband Danny Dyer and insists he will always be part of her "family".
She told OK! magazine: "I love him to pieces, we even call each other second cousins.
"When you work together the hours we do, you can’t help but become very close, but Danny really is one of my best friends. Whatever happens in the future I know he’ll stay in my life – him and his family will stay part of my family."
Meanwhile, Kelly took to Twitter to reveal she was pregnant earlier this year.
She shared at the time: "Shhh… Don’t tell anyone, but I’m pregnant! My hubby and I are over the moon & looking forward 2 meeting our little person in Nov #Mama@40 …
"And for those of you that want to know, I will be returning to @bbceastenders after I’ve had the baby #queenvicismyhome #LindaCarter4ever xx (sic)."
